Just got an update from the dealership, the Jeep was assembled with a faulty Transmission solenoid .. That was throwing the error code and was causing the remote start to disengage as it was not registering that the vehicle was in park.

Glad you got your problem sorted.

Couple things. Auto Start and Remote start are two different things.

The list given in a previous reply is for auto Start/Stop. The reason I know this is that the Remote start will NOT be disabled bu the first item "Driver's Seat belt being unbuckled"

Remote start has it's own list of things that can disable it.
Hood being open, Door being open/off, Low Fuel... etc....

I've got a 24 Rubi with the Aux battery disconnected.
I have been getting the "Aux Switches temporarily unavailable". Now I'm also getting the "Remote Start disabled".
It was working until it got below freezing and now remote start is not working.
This morning I tried starting remotely and no go. I started it normally and the Aux Switches were also disabled. I started it, ran it for a few minutes until the Aux Switches worked, then it started remotely. So I'm leaning to the battery which is 2.5 years since purchase.
bad battery and aux battery will cause the AUX Switches error 99% of the time and if your battery is low the remote start will do exactly that behaviour.
